Advise please,Im a UK resident married to a Thai lady for 1 year,we have 2 children both have UK passports,I want us all to go to the UK for a holliday.When I look at the visa aplication form for my wifes visa im puzzled by the children section which seems to suggest they need visas,I thought that as the kids have UK passports all we would have to do is turn up at the airport and get on a plane.Has anyone on here visited the UK with kids and could you advise.Many thanks.ps,new member 1st time on here.

If your kids have UK passports,of course they dont need UK visa.We registered the births in Thailand for our 2 boys and got them Thai passports aswell.When going uk-bkk show thai passport on arrival.When going bkk-uk show uk passport on arrival.No visa.

Do you know if my Thai wife has to declare on her visa application form that children are traveling with her,or can we just turn up at the airport with the kids and board.?Thanks for your last reply.

moved to the visa's section where it will get a better response.

On the visitor visa, apply as a familly visit, mention the two children are travelling, but do not need a visa. The form does not cater for this, but I was told to mention our child, and we got the missus a visa.

I assume you will be acting as your wifes sponsor, and mention of the children should help with the application.
